Puffer Malarkey Collective To Reopen Restaurants Starting June 19th

Puffer Malarkey Collective is thrilled to reopen their restaurants. Herb & Sea will open Friday, June 19, followed by Herb & Wood on July 8, and Animae on July 22.

All dining rooms will be reconfigured to meet the new guidelines, and menus will be available to view on patron’s phones via a QR code located at each table. Staff will undergo training on the new operating protocols mandated by state and government and new hospitality standards that will ensure the dining experience is as safe as possible, while preserving PMC’s service expectations and dining room ambiance. A selection of menu items will also be made available for takeout at nightly at each restaurant and can be ordered via the websites.

Herb & Sea

Opens Friday, June 19th
131 D Street, Encinitas
Wednesday to Sunday, 5:00 – 9:00 p.m.

After opening in 2019, Herb & Sea quickly became Encinitas’ buzziest neighborhood restaurant, with lines forming at the door nightly before dinner service and full dining rooms until the night they closed. The restaurant is excited to welcome back the neighborhood on Friday, June 19, serving dinner starting at 5:00 p.m. every Wednesday through Sunday. Executive Chef Sara Harris’ menu includes classic Chef Malarkey dishes like the Roasted Baby Carrots and Whole Branzino, and a few of the restaurant’s greatest hits including Hamachi Crudo, and Roasted Oysters & Bone Marrow.

Herb & Wood

Opens July 8th
2210 Kettner Blvd, Little Italy
Wednesday & Thursday, 5:00 – 9:00 p.m., Friday to Sunday, 5:00 p.m. to close

The Little Italy dining room, which celebrated its 4th anniversary this April amidst the pandemic, shines back to life on Monday, July 8. Guests will enjoy all the favorites from Herb & Wood’s kitchen they’ve been missing, including the Oxtail Gnocchi (Chef Beau MacMillan called this the best dish he ever ate), Roasted Half Chicken, and Blistered Tomato & Burrata. Herb & Wood’s expansive dining room and covered patio will allow for plenty of social distancing, but reservations are not required, but are recommended as seating will be limited to abide by the rules. Herb & Eatery will remain closed while the team focuses on Herb & Wood’s reopening.

Animae

Opens July 22nd
969 Pacific Hwy, Marina District
Tuesday to Thursday, 5:00 – 9:00 p.m., Friday and Saturday, 5:00 to close

San Diego’s most glamorous dining room returns with its seductive atmosphere and innovative cuisine. The jewel-toned booths and ceiling length curtains invite diners to forget about quarantine and revel in a bit of normalcy. Diners will enjoy their favorite dishes from the original coal-fired, Asian-inspired menu, alongside a new Wagyu beef program, and a lighter and brighter summer menu. A newly revamped cocktail menu features a more approachable, playful take on ANIMAE’s spirits program. Nima Café will remain closed for the time being.
